About the Data Engineering Team

Thumbtack’s Data Engineering team is a centralized team that works closely with engineers, analysts, data scientists, and machine learning engineers to help design and curate data sets originating from internal and third-party sources to meet current and future needs. Over the next year, it will continue to build on its prior successes in building a more cohesive data warehouse while starting to work more deeply upstream to build data best practices into the full software development lifecycle (SDLC).

About the Role

As a Senior Data Engineer, you will work closely with product and engineering teams throughout Thumbtack, helping turn data into insight into action. The Data Engineering team is a hybrid-embedded team of engineers, some of whom consult directly with product teams to integrate data into the development lifecycle, and others who help build core pipelines and data models for use across the entire company. You’ll work to understand requirements, then design, deploy, test, and deploy data pipelines and transformations for use by Analysts, Machine Learning Engineers, and Data Scientists, and Product Managers. Major project areas include: working across product and marketing data teams to build a centralized customer data warehouse, developing advanced ingress/egress validation in the data lake, and modeling cost of supply acquisition for our two-sided marketplace.
